Description:
RESPONSIBILITES:
- Facilitates all functions of the human resources department in accordance with established policies and procedures.
- Responsible for the development, implementation and maintenance of personnel policies and procedures. Also responsible for maintaining personnel records.
- Coordinate the advertising, recruitment, initial screening and appropriately refer candidates to fill approved positions.
- Responsible for new-employee orientation and on-boarding process.
- Oversee the employee performance review process and related documentation.
- Manage the development, revision and maintenance of the job description process.
- Counsel employees on job-related issues affecting their performance.
- Oversee the planning and coordination of training, development activities, and employee appreciation for the bank.
- Facilitate/organize monthly staff meetings and attend other meetings and seminars that may include travel.
- Keep informed on trends in personnel administration.
- Complies with all policies, practices and procedures. Reports all irregular activities to supervisor and/or the President & CEO.
- Participates in proactive team effort to achieve departmental and Bank goals.
- Provides leadership to others by example and sharing of knowledge/skill.
- Cross train with Accounting Officer on payroll functions and benefit administration.
- Complete all initial and annual training requirements as outlined by ASBT.
- Perform all other duties as required, consistent with the goals, objectives and responsibilities of the Administration Department.
Requirements:
QUALIFICATIONS:
- Bachelors’ degree in human resources, personnel or business administration, or related field.
- Financial Institution background and PHR or SPHR certification a plus.
- Background in hiring and training systems would be helpful.
- Good human resources skills to effectively direct others, make decisions and communicate clearly.
- Basic knowledge of personnel administration principles, wage and salary administration, job analysis, compensation, employment and other labor laws and retirement plans and programs.
- Excellent writing and verbal communication skills.
- Good organization and time management skills necessary.
S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S:
- Confidentiality and tactfulness in dealing with bank and customer information is mandatory.
- Ability to conduct relationships with co-workers, customers, the community and the overall public in a manner which will enhance the Bank’s image and comprehensive marketing effort.
- Will be called upon from time to time to participate with community organizations and projects
